Southern Vermont loses Red Sox broadcasts

Sports now history at WEEY

By Ted Cohen

The Brattleboro-area radio station featuring live sports including Red Sox games is ditching the format.

From now on WEEY is streaming country music due to a change in ownership.

The sale leaves the region with no sports - including Celtics, Bruins and the NFL - on the airwaves.

“Another WEEI/Red Sox station bites the dust,” said Boston Radio Watch. “Full ownership change means format flip. They're falling like flies.”

WEEI 93.5 broadcast in southern Vermont and Keene, NH as WEEY, which has been sold to Community Media.

“We want to sincerely thank our listeners, advertisers, community partners, and everyone who has been part of this incredible journey over the past 20 years,” station officials posted on Facebook. “It has been an absolute pleasure serving our community, bringing to you the best New England sports coverage.”

The programming change comes amid major cutbacks by IHeartMedia, a nationwide radio conglomerate that owns WEEI, known as New England's Sports Network.
